BLRX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2015 in Review

23 of the 3,824 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in BioLineRX (BLRX) for Q4 2015, worth a combined $13.6M — down 20% from $17M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 4 funds opened new BLRX positions and 2 closed out — a net gain of 2 holders — while 3 added to existing stakes and 6 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Menta Capital, adding an estimated $58.1K. The largest seller was Alyeska Investment Group, cutting an estimated $480K.
